この関数を使って、ループの外側から複数のデータを取得できるようにしています。
function get_post_data($postId) {
global $wpdb;
return $wpdb->get_results("SELECT * FROM $wpdb->posts WHERE ID=$postId");
}
...そして、投稿が公開された日付を表示します。
<?php
global $wp_query;
global $thePostID;
$thePostID = $wp_query->post->ID;
$data = get_post_data($thePostID);
echo $data[0]->post_date;
?>
サイドバーに "2010-06-14 22:36:03"のようなものが表示されますが、フォーマットは "2010年6月"のようにしてください。
できますか?
私はこのようなものを使っています:
date('F, Y', strtotime($data[0]->post_date));